defang
Example
The zookeeper defanged the poisonous snake to make it safe for visitors. [defanged: past tense]
Example
The new regulations aim to defang the power of big tech companies. [defang: verb]
disarm
Example
The police officer disarmed the suspect by taking away his gun. [disarmed: past tense]
Example
The negotiator's goal was to disarm the tense situation and find a peaceful resolution. [disarm: verb]

Which word is more common?
Disarm is more commonly used than defang in everyday language, due to its wider range of applications.
What’s the difference in the tone of formality between defang and disarm?
Both defang and disarm are formal words that are typically used in serious or professional contexts, such as in discussions of military or political conflicts.
